Abstract | Produksi cabai merah terkendala adanya hama dan penyakit tanaman. Virus ChiMV (Chilli Veinal MottleVirus) adalah salah satu penyakit tanaman yang dapat menurunkan hasil cabai merah. Perakitan hibrida cabaimerah yang hasil tinggi dan tahan penyakit virus ChiVMV diperlukan informasi antara lain daya gabung umum,khusus, heterosis, letak gen dan heritabititas. Penelitian ini bertujuan untuk : 1). mendapatkan nilai daya gabungumum dan khusus, 2). memperoleh nilai heterosis dari sejumlah persilangan yang ada, 3). memperoleh nilaiheritabilitas dari sifat ketahanan terhadap virus ChiVMV. ChiMV virus is off important disease thatcould decrease chilli pepper production. Genetic information, such as genetic parameter, combining ability,heterosis and heritability is required in order to improve resistance variety. The researchâÂÂs objectives were: 1)to estimate the general combining ability (GCA) and specific combining ability (SCA), 2) to estimate theheterosis of several diallel mating, 3) to estimate heritability of resistance to ChiMV virus. It was evidenced that:1) genetype of chilli pepper having low GCA (desease intensity) were G6321 and X4271, 2) genetypes of chillipepper resulted from diallel mating of X4271xG6321, dan G3257xX4271 low high SCA on desease intensity toChiMV virus, 3) base on SCA, heterosis, disease intensity, fruit weigh, X4271xG6321,G3257xx4271 danG3257x Jatilaba genotypes could be selected for high yielding chili and resistance to ChiMV virus, 4) boardsense heritability values of observed character were high, but range of narrow sense heritability were high tolow, 5) resistance character to ChiMV virus was influenced by maternal effect.Key words: combining ability, heterosis, heritability, ChiMV resistance, maternal effect |
